Output 14d69ad7883d48d859350fdef41586e493ecc9f0545fae59cf80bb0cf7a726aa:0

value
5085203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af410a87f81bb56ca98f3f97576e2547af1d75ad OP_EQUAL
address
3Hfg6FYMj8zEpTGWLgMScuvyr8es7tGENn
transaction
14d69ad7883d48d859350fdef41586e493ecc9f0545fae59cf80bb0cf7a726aa
confirmations
238506
spent
true